Appeal after stolen bank card used at service stations

News | Rhys Williams | Published: 15:20, Wednesday April 24th, 2019.
Last updated: 15:21, Wednesday April 24th, 2019

Gwent Police would like to speak to this man

Police are investigating after a stolen bank card was fraudulently used on two separate occasions.

The bank card was in a wallet that was stolen from a property in Rowan Place, Rhymney at around 9.45pm on Thursday, March 21.

The card was first used in a service station in Dowlais at around midnight on Friday, March 22.

Gwent Police would like to speak to this man, pictured at a Dowlais service station

It was then used again at the Premier Shop on Upper High Street, Rhymney, at around 7.15am.

Gwent Police would like to identify the men pictured in CCTV images.

The man pictured at the service station in Dowlais is believed to have been driving a red Vauxhall Astra with the registration number CK66 GVO.

The red Vauxhall Astra pictured outside Valley Heights Service Station, Dowlais

Anyone with information can contact Gwent Police on 101.

Alternatively, Crimestoppers can be contacted anonymously on 0800 555 111.
